Which side of the plane to sit from Leonardo da Vinci–Fiumicino Airport (Rome) to Peretola Airport (Florence)?
Right Side of the Plane
The right side offers an exceptional perspective of the classic Tuscan landscape, including rolling vineyards, volcanic lakes, and the iconic Florence skyline during the final descent.
Lake Bracciano
A deep, circular volcanic lake surrounded by dense forests and the Odescalchi Castle.
Chianti Vineyards
The quintessential Italian countryside view featuring neat rows of vines and cypress-lined driveways.
Siena
From a high altitude, the distinct burnt-sienna color of this medieval city is visible against the green hills.
Florence Cathedral
During the approach into FLR, the massive Brunelleschi's Dome is often visible as the plane glides over the Arno valley.
The right side is superior for landmarks. Morning flights are ideal here as the sun illuminates the hills of Tuscany without creating glare. On the descent into Peretola, the plane usually approaches from the southeast, giving passengers on the right a magnificent view of the historic center of Florence and the Duomo if landing on Runway 05. Check the wind direction; a southerly wind ensures this iconic view during the final seconds of flight.
Tyrrhenian Coastline
Dramatic views of the blue Mediterranean waves meeting the Italian shore shortly after takeoff.
Port of Civitavecchia
One of Italy's busiest cruise ports, easily identifiable by the massive white ships docked in the harbor.
Monte Argentario
A stunning rocky promontory linked to the mainland by three narrow strips of land forming lagoons.
Giglio Island
On clear days, look out towards the sea to spot the rugged silhouette of this famous Tuscan island.
Sit on the left if you are flying in the late afternoon or early evening; you will catch the sun setting over the Tyrrhenian Sea. This side is also excellent for spotting the Tuscan archipelago if the flight path remains coastal. Keep your camera ready shortly after takeoff as the plane banks north from FCO.
